Pattern Formation
Positioning of cells during development that determines the final shape of an organism.
Fetus
The stage of development in mammals following the embryonic stage, characterized by rapid growth and maturation of organs and systems.
Development
The process through which living organisms grow and become more complex, involving physical, biological, and sometimes psychological changes.
Human Blastocyst
A stage of human embryonic development that occurs approximately 5 to 9 days post-fertilization, characterized by a sphere of cells enclosing a fluid-filled cavity and the inner cell mass that will develop into the embryo.
